<p>February 25th was a day we dreamed about, prayed over and anticipated for over three years.</p>



<p>Before the pandemic, my friend and <a href="https://stephaniewilkinscnc.com/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">Certified Nutrional Counselor Stephanie Wilkins</a> and I had planned to start working with women&#8217;s shelters, bringing the Good News of the gospel and sharing free Bible studies with women in transition homes in the Atlanta metropolitan area.</p>



<p>Then the pandemic hit and stopped the program before it even began.</p>



<p>Fast forward three years, and we now realize that the &#8220;pause&#8221; only served to improve the original plan. Only God can turn a disappointment into something much better than we originally planned (<a href="https://www.biblegateway.com/passage/?search=Genesis%2050%3A20&amp;version=NIV"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">Genesis 20:20</a>).</p>


<hr /><p><em>Only God can turn a disappointment into something much better than we originally planned.</em><br /><a href='https://twitter.com/intent/tweet?url=https%3A%2F%2Fwp.me%2Fp7aKvF-21k&#038;text=Only%20God%20can%20turn%20a%20disappointment%20into%20something%20much%20better%20than%20we%20originally%20planned.&#038;via=PatHolbrook&#038;related=PatHolbrook' target='_blank' rel="noopener noreferrer" >Click To Tweet</a><br /><hr />


<h3 class="wp-block-heading">City of Refuge</h3>



<p>Our first Love Day partner was <a href="https://www.hocatl.org/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">House of Cherith</a>, the &#8220;safe house&#8221; inside <a href="https://cityofrefugeatl.org/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">City of Refuge</a>, providing safety and guidance for women who are victims of abuse or sexual exploitation. This incredible ministry provides Safe housing and supportive services where women can recover from the trauma of sexual exploitation.</p>



<figure class="wp-block-gallery aligncenter has-nested-images columns-default is-cropped wp-block-gallery-1 is-layout-flex wp-block-gallery-is-layout-flex">
<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://i0.wp.com/so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/Untitled-design-24.png?ssl=1"><img data-recalc-dims="1" decoding="async" width="768" height="1024" data-id="7773" src="https://i0.wp.com/so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/Untitled-design-24-768x1024.png?resize=768%2C1024&#038;ssl=1" alt="" class="wp-image-7773" srcset="https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/Untitled-design-24.png?resize=768%2C1024&amp;ssl=1 768w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/Untitled-design-24.png?resize=225%2C300&amp;ssl=1 225w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/Untitled-design-24.png?resize=1152%2C1536&amp;ssl=1 1152w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/Untitled-design-24.png?w=1536&amp;ssl=1 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 768px) 100vw, 768px" /></a></figure>
</figure>



<p>The day started with worship led by Soaring with Him&#8217;s worship leader and my dear friend Chasity Dedman. The Holy Spirit&#8217;s presence was powerful as these women raised their voices to worship their Redeemer. </p>



<p>Next, I brought a message of hope and encouragement from <a href="https://www.biblegateway.com/passage/?search=Jeremiah+17%3A5-8&amp;version=NIV"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">Jeremiah 17 </a>&#8211; The Tree and the Bush, after which we had an altar call with several ladies coming for prayer. </p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://i0.wp.com/so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/Untitled-design-25-1.png?ssl=1"><img data-recalc-dims="1" decoding="async" width="768" height="1024" src="https://i0.wp.com/so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/Untitled-design-25-1-768x1024.png?resize=768%2C1024&#038;ssl=1" alt="" class="wp-image-7775" srcset="https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/Untitled-design-25-1.png?resize=768%2C1024&amp;ssl=1 768w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/Untitled-design-25-1.png?resize=225%2C300&amp;ssl=1 225w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/Untitled-design-25-1.png?resize=1152%2C1536&amp;ssl=1 1152w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/Untitled-design-25-1.png?w=1536&amp;ssl=1 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 768px) 100vw, 768px" /></a></figure>



<p>We then broke for lunch and group prayer time, where each volunteer prayed with a small group.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ading">Bible Distribution and Course</h3>



<p>In the afternoon, we gave the ladies a personal copy of the Bible, together with a small gift from our new partner, <a href="https://www.theencouragementproject.org/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">The Encouragement Project</a>. We also delivered four copies of <a href="https://www.tyndale.com/sites/lasb/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">Tyndale&#8217;s Life Application Bible</a> to be placed in the four main rooms of the shelter. </p>



<p>It was then that I taught my brand-new course, Equipped to Listen to God, which is still not available to the public (it&#8217;ll be available at our new website soon!). The course teaches people how to listen to God through the Bible.  </p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-large"><a href="https://i0.wp.com/so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/equipped-cover-scaled.jpg?ssl=1"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" width="1920" height="2560" src="https://i0.wp.com/so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/equipped-cover-scaled.jpg?fit=768%2C1024&amp;ssl=1" alt="" class="wp-image-7776" srcset="https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/equipped-cover-scaled.jpg?w=1920&amp;ssl=1 1920w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/equipped-cover-scaled.jpg?resize=225%2C300&amp;ssl=1 225w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/equipped-cover-scaled.jpg?resize=768%2C1024&amp;ssl=1 768w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/equipped-cover-scaled.jpg?resize=1152%2C1536&amp;ssl=1 1152w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/03/equipped-cover-scaled.jpg?resize=1536%2C2048&amp;ssl=1 1536w" sizes="(max-width: 1000px) 100vw, 1000px" /></a></figure>



<p>The ladies were thrilled to attend the course and receive their own personal copy of the course book. At the end, there were several testimonies of how the bibles and the course blessed them. </p>



<p>We finished the day with a hand pampering section from our new ministry partners and dear friends, Mary Kay&#8217;s representatives Vicki Morton Hartin and Judy Womack. Judy is also our Agape Shelter Ministry coordinator.</p>

<p>Robia Scott is an actress, Christian speaker, coach, and author. She has helped countless Christian women around the world conquer their counterfeit comfort of food and experience the peace, purpose, and passion for which they were created.</p>



<p>Listen to Patricia&#8217;s interview with Robia, where they discussed her ministry as well as the revival of her acting career after fifteen years away from Hollywood.&nbsp;She recently returned to acting in a starring role in <a href="https://www.unplannedfilm.com/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">Unplanned</a>-a major motion picture with a pro-life message. God strategically used Robia’s acting talent for a Kingdom message of hope and redemption.</p>



<p>Patricia and Robia talked about her new movie, <a href="https://www.rottentomatoes.com/m/pursuit_of_freedom"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">Pursuit of Freedom</a>, based on a true story of a Ukrainian woman who was separated from her three children and sold into trafficking by Russian gangsters.</p>

<p>In 2007, the U.S. Senate designated Jan. 11 as <a href="https://www.justice.gov/usao-vt/pr/january-11-2021-national-day-human-trafficking-awareness">National Human Trafficking Awareness Day</a>. Since then, awareness and advocacy campaigns have expanded to the entire month of January throughout the country, as both secular and religious organizations expose the horrors of modern-day human trafficking and slavery in America and beyond.</p>
<p>It is hard to wrap our minds around slavery as a modern-day issue, especially in the world’s most prosperous country. According to the <a href="https://www.globalslaveryindex.org/">Global Slavery Index</a>, an estimated 403,000 people lived in conditions of modern slavery in the United States in 2016.</p>
<p>As alarming as the potential number of victims in the United States may seem, the numbers pale compared to the regions where the issue is most prevalent. In countries in the African and Asian continents, sex slavery and labor exploitation take various forms and are often initiated by the victims’ own families.</p>
<p>According to a report from the <a href="http://www.ilo.org/global/about-the-ilo/lang--en/index.htm">International Labor Organization</a> (ILO) and <a href="https://www.minderoo.org/walk-free/">Walk Free Foundation</a> published in 2017, an estimated 24.9 million people were victims of modern-day slavery in the world at that time. More recent reports indicate that the victim pool has increased to approximately 40 million people.</p>
<p>A more recent infographic released by the same foundation exposes the gender discrepancy surrounding the issue: 98% of all victims of human trafficking and slavery in the world are women and girls. According to this report, 1 in 130 women and girls live in modern-day slavery in the world. They constitute 99% of forced sexual exploitation victims, 84% of all forced marriages and 58% of all forced labor victims.</p>
<p>As a mother of girls, I cannot fathom that families would sell their precious young daughters to be sexually exploited in brothels or marry a man decades her senior. But this is the reality of a growing number of girls in impoverished countries — a fact that has become even more prevalent during the global pandemic.</p>
<p>According to <a href="https://www.linkedin.com/in/michele-rickett-11843211/">Michele Rickett</a>, award-winning author and president of <a href="https://sheissafe.org/">She Is Safe</a>, “Human trafficking is at an all-time high as people are more desperate for help. Families that would not otherwise sell their daughters are doing so in order to feed their other family members.”</p>
<p>Founded in 2002 and headquartered in Roswell, She Is Safe has been engaged in the fight against human slavery in seven countries in high-risk areas of the world — places that often treat the trade and exploitation of women and girls as an inevitable part of their culture.</p>
<p>These patriarch communities see a girl’s birth as a liability, a generational issue deeply ingrained in these societies. Naturally, these girls grow up with incredibly low self-esteem and a sense of helplessness, a paradigm that only exacerbates the problem.</p>
<p>Rather than focusing solely on rescuing the victims, the She Is Safe process focuses on life beyond slavery. The programs are implemented in a collaboration between the U.S. staff and local partners — women, churches and non-profits.</p>
<p>One of their initiatives is called “Transformation Groups.” The program offers women and girls opportunities to join in groups of 10-20 that meet weekly to learn, save and lend. They learn income-generating and small business success skills. They also create a saving and lending pool within the group and become officers of the lending group, helping women not fall prey to money lender’s usury — an issue that has become even greater due to the dire economic conditions in these communities during the pandemic.</p>
<p>Rickett talks about the program during the pandemic with contagious enthusiasm and zeal: “By the grace of God, we have been able to pivot and provide food, and encourage women in our groups to make soap, masks, disinfectant, food … to become essential service providers! The increase of a sense of self-worth has been remarkable.”</p>

<p><em>“I have walked the brothel hallways with our partners in West Bengal and seen little children living under the beds of their young mothers, who are sex slaves. Without intervention, children of sex slaves are put to work in the brothel at an even younger age than their mothers.”</em><u></u><u></u></p>
<p>I sat across from Michele Rickett, founder and president of She is Safe – an international organization with a mission to “prevent, rescue and restore women and girls from abuse and slavery in high-risk places around the world.”<u></u><u></u></p>
<p>I could barely finish my lunch. A mix of indignation, perplexity and excitement filled my heart, as Michele shared the heartbreaking stories of lives that are being saved, rescued and changed around the world through her organization.<u></u><u></u></p>
<p>In the beginning of this year, as I started to pray about the staff for my ministry’s upcoming annual women’s conference in October, I felt compelled to invite a local organization involved in the fight against human trafficking to share a testimony about their work during the conference.<u></u><u></u></p>
<p>A couple of months later, I met Michele at a mission’s conference. As she shared her organization’s work around the world, I immediately knew that She Is Safe was the answer to my prayers.<u></u><u></u></p>
<p>What started with a spark of interest turned into a passion to bring awareness about a problem that is sweeping the globe: the murder and slavery of girls in impoverished countries, simply because of their gender.<u></u><u></u></p>
<p>According to a 2010 article of the Economist magazine, “Gendercide” has killed over 100 million girls around the world. Newer research indicates that the number may now be closer to 200 million.<u></u><u></u></p>
<p>Michele elaborates on the heart-wrenching facts: “The debasing view of girls leads many families to rid themselves of these children, seeing girls as a worthless drain on family resources. The root cause of the murder of girls (gendercide), whether through feticide or infanticide, is the hideously distorted view of a girl’s value. And, of course, there is a powerful vacuum, on many levels, when girls are missing from communities. One of the most sinister is the trade in human beings, or human trafficking, which supplies a massive demand for girls.”<u></u><u></u></p>
<p><img data-recalc-dims="1" lo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="aligncenter wp-image-2595" src="https://i0.wp.com/so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/05/AJC-05.27.17-She-is-Safe-001.jpg?resize=600%2C376&#038;ssl=1" alt="" width="600" height="376" srcset="https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/05/AJC-05.27.17-She-is-Safe-001.jpg?w=2041&amp;ssl=1 2041w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/05/AJC-05.27.17-She-is-Safe-001.jpg?resize=300%2C188&amp;ssl=1 300w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/05/AJC-05.27.17-She-is-Safe-001.jpg?resize=768%2C482&amp;ssl=1 768w, https://i0.wp.com/temporaldomainfwg.soaringwithhim.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/05/AJC-05.27.17-She-is-Safe-001.jpg?resize=1024%2C642&amp;ssl=1 1024w" sizes="(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px" />Indeed, according to the United Nations Office on Drugs and Crime, 80 percent of human trafficking victims are girls and women, and 98 percent of sex slaves are female.<u></u><u></u></p>
<p>Sex slavery and child prostitution are on top of the list of other horrendous issues that plague these countries. Child marriage, physical abuse, female genital mutilation, rape, honor killings, malnutrition, oppression. The list is too large and too distressing.<u></u><u></u></p>
